Traditional Enchantment

Classic Silhouettes

The magic of Diwali lies in its age-old traditions, and what better way to honor them than with classic silhouettes? Sarees, the epitome of Indian grace, are an evergreen choice. Embrace rich fabrics like silk, georgette, and brocade, adorned with intricate embroidery or vibrant prints that capture the festive spirit.

Regal Kurtis

For those seeking a more regal look, kurtis are an elegant option. Long, flowing kurtas with intricate embellishments like zari, thread work, or mirror work will add a touch of grandeur to your Diwali ensemble. Pair them with palazzo pants or lehengas for an ethereal appeal.

Ethnic Jackets

Ethnic jackets are the perfect fusion of traditional charm and contemporary style. From vibrant Nehru jackets to embellished bandi jackets, there’s a jacket for every personality and preference. Wear them over sarees, dresses, or kurtas to create a unique and festive look.

Contemporary Elegance

Fusion Ensembles

Diwali 2018 is all about embracing fusion. Mix and match traditional pieces with contemporary elements to create outfits that are both stylish and festive. Pair a silk saree with a modern blouse, or wear a traditional kurta with ethnic pants and a statement necklace.

Indo-Western Outfits

Indo-Western outfits seamlessly blend Eastern and Western sensibilities. Opt for chic jumpsuits with ethnic patterns, stylish tunics with traditional motifs, or flowing gowns with intricate embroidery. These outfits allow you to celebrate Diwali with a modern twist without sacrificing the essence of the festival.

Festive Separates

If you prefer a more versatile wardrobe, consider investing in festive separates. Embroidered skirts, flowy palazzos, and stylish blouses can be mixed and matched to create multiple outfits, ensuring you have a different look for each day of the festivities.

Festive Colors and Embellishments

Color Palette

Diwali is a festival of light, and it’s reflected in the vibrant colors of traditional attire. Opt for rich hues like red, gold, green, and purple. These colors symbolize prosperity, joy, and good fortune, making them perfect for the Diwali season.

Embellishments

No Diwali outfit is complete without embellishments. Intricate embroidery, shimmering sequins, and sparkling stones add an element of glamour to any ensemble. From elaborate necklines to embellished hemlines, there are countless ways to incorporate these details into your Diwali attire.
